Output 3af6ab0f315dbb3a9124430d058120928efcf74091c7e81af414bc4f045f6025:10

value
105757514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bf3623a172d75560a89d6b444fd7d5f3d9b62a1 OP_EQUAL
address
MGHMHUwnBmh7ZeNbszQT91Koq73xDjE4b3
transaction
3af6ab0f315dbb3a9124430d058120928efcf74091c7e81af414bc4f045f6025
spent
true